NOTICE
To prevent damaging the smart key:
Keep the smart key in a cool,
dry place to avoid damage or
malfunction. Exposure to moisture
or high temperature may cause
the internal circuit of the smart key
to malfunction which may not be
covered under warranty.
Avoid dropping or throwing the
smart key.
Protect the smart key from extreme
temperatures.
Remote start
You can start the vehicle using the
Remote Start button (7) of the smart key.
To start the vehicle remotely:
Lock the doors by pressing the door
lock button within 32 feet (10 m)
distance from the vehicle.
Press the remote start button for over
2 seconds within 4 seconds after
locking the doors and the hazard
warning will blink.
To turn off the remote start function, press
the remote start button once. In case of
the manual operation, the climate control
system will be maintained even when
the engine is turned OFF. However, the
automatic operation is set to 72°F (22°C).
Remote smart parking assist (RSPA)
(if equipped)
The Remote smart parking assist (RSPA)
system helps the drivers park their
vehicle by using sensors to measure
parking spaces and control the steering
wheel, gear shift and vehicle speed to
semi-automatically park the vehicle.
With the smart key, the driver can move
the vehicle forward or backward using
the rearward /forward buttons (5, 6) on
the smart key.
